      when the sensors are active (reverse gear ignition on, engine off) you put your finger on the sensor approximately 2 mm from the sensor. Put your ear close to the sensor. If you hear the sound of a soft knock, it means that the sensor is correct.If you dont hear that sensor is dead,
      Unfortunately you will have to remove the bumper to replace the sensor

      After you release all the buckles and screws that hold it (including those under the taillights) you have to release it on the left and right. After that there is one sheet metal holder that holds it along its entire length along the trunk seal itself. Lift the complete bumper slightly upwards and it should come loose if you have done everything properly
